Lagrange, Indiana

Incorporated municipality · Population 2,769

Lagrange is an incorporated municipality of 2,769 residents in Indiana. Its nearest regional center is Elkhart, IN, about 45 minutes away by car. The median home value is $150,100.

The case

Why Lagrange is included

Lagrange appears in the public directory because it passes every published screening rule: its population of 2,769 falls within the 1,000–5,000 resident screening band; its nearest regional center, Elkhart, is reachable in about 45 minutes by car, inside the 60-minute limit; its town-center walkability analysis completed successfully.

Beyond the screen: its median home value of $150,100 is about 2.8 times median household income; its nationally normalized walkability score is 71 out of 100; OpenStreetMap data records 20 tracked everyday destinations within a 15-minute walk of its center.

72.8

The walkability score models what can be reached on foot from the town center over the street network in about 15 minutes: everyday destinations, the connectedness of the street grid, and the compactness of the town's form. Scores are normalized nationally across the candidate corpus, from 0 to 100.

These are modeled measures of urban form derived from OpenStreetMap. They do not confirm sidewalk coverage, crossings, lighting, or pedestrian safety, and OpenStreetMap data may be incomplete in small towns.
